NOTES AND COMMENTS.

The Cornell Sun is to be enlarged.

Columbia freshmen are enterprising enough to compile a volume of class songs all their own.

Hon. Geo. Bancroft will preside at the 100th anniversary of the Phillips Exeter Academy next June.

Dr. Perry has introduced into his classes the study of Greek roots as at present pursued at Harvard College. - [Columbia Spectator.

A recent will gave about $400,000 for the establishment of a college for the higher education of young women, in Philadelphia. The fund, however, will not be available for nearly a century. The young women will then be mature enough to profit by it.
